Foods That Taste Good and are Healthy
1. Beans and Lentils
They are rich in protein, fiber, complex
carbohydrates, iron, magnesium, potassium, and zinc. Beans are versatile
and easy on your wallet.
2. Watermelon
One of the most popular fruits during the
summer, watermelon "should be a staple in everyone’s diet. "It
is fun to eat, sweet, juicy, low in calories, and chock full of vitamins C and
A, potassium, and lycopene (cancer fighting agent and a powerful antioxidant).
Because it is so high in water, it helps meet fluid needs."
3. Sweet Potatoes
Sweet potatoes are high in vitamin B6. They are
also a good source of vitamin C, vitamin D, iron, and magnesium.
4. Plain, Nonfat Greek Yogurt
Greek yogurt is an excellent source of
calcium, potassium, protein, zinc, and vitamins B6 and B12. Also, it
contains probiotic cultures and is lower in lactose and has twice the protein
content of regular yogurts. Greek yogurt contains twice as much protein than
other yogurt choices.
